The Tom Bates Regional Sports Complex, founded by the East Bay Regional Park District, is a community athletic facility in Albany, CA serving athletes from several nearby cities including Berkeley and Richmond. The complex features sports fields for soccer, lacrosse, rugby, and other local teams, with a focus on eco-friendly practices such as synthetic turf and grey water usage.
